OFFICIAL LANGUAGES - TOOLS AND RESOURCES

Whether you're seeking to improve your knowledge or use of one of Canada's two official languages, or help your organization or others to do so, there is a government resource for you. CultureCanada.gc.ca has put together this list of resources on Canada's official languages.


Learning English with the CBC
  This series of on-line lessons is designed to help people learn to speak and read English. The lessons offer media clips from the CBC's archives, along with questions and exercises for each clip.
   
LangCanada.ca
  LangCanada.ca is an online portal to English as a Second Language (ESL) and French as a Second Language (FSL) training programs and materials in Canada. The site hosts a searchable collection of more than 3,000 educational resources for language learners, as well as more than 500 training organizations throughout the country.
   
Making Your Organization Bilingual
  This Canadian Heritage site offers tools and strategies for organizations that want to foster a new bilingual corporate culture and for those who would like to improve the services they already offer in Canada's two official languages. The material is general enough to be adaptable to the needs of voluntary, private and public-sector organizations.
   
Youth Express
  This section of the Official Languages Commissioner's site offers resources for young people, parents and teachers. Resources include interactive games, videos and posters on Canada's official languages.
